[SOLVED] .NET and Windows 8
Hi all,
I want to understand how installing an application that requires .net works on windows 8.
I've seen this question: http://superuser.com/q/491000/85165 but don't know how it works in practice.
Will the user need to download .net 3.5 separately to a download of my program if its required, or will they install it from the CD, or is it already on their HDD with windows, but not activated?

Re: .NET and Windows 8
The user will not have to download anything. I can't recall whether the original media was required to enable that feature or not but it's definitely not an extra download.
